-- Lint config client for Quarrel, our SQL style checker.
-- Rules live in the shared ruleset repo; do not inline overrides here.
-- Violations block merge; support can grant one-sprint waivers only.
-- This client fetches rulesets from the internal Quarrel registry,
-- which requires authentication on every request.
-- The registry key for this environment is set below.

gateway credential: kto3_qfe

Artifact Signing — PixelVault Image Cache Hotfix

Quick notes for whoever reviews the leak fix: the Ondrel image cache was holding decoded bitmaps past eviction, so the hotfix swaps in weak references. Once you approve the diff, the build bot produces a signed bundle — unsigned hotfixes get rejected by the Marrowfield updater, no exceptions. For local verification of the bundle, the reviewer copy of the signing key is:

release key, fahaf-bajof: bky3_Xam

### Capacity note: N+1 fix in the Fernwheel GraphQL gateway

The batched loader replaces per-field resolver queries with keyed batches, cutting database round trips roughly 40x on the worst dashboard query. Memory per request rises slightly because batches are buffered, so I sized the cache and batch windows against peak traffic from last quarter. Reviewer: the main thing to check is that these values stay within the pod memory budget. The constants are set as follows.

tuning constants:
QUOTAS = {
    "druwyn": 5,
    "holix": 5,
    "zorath": 5,
    "holwyn": 10,
}

This page documents how Hushline release artifacts are traced from source to deployment. Each deduplicator build is produced on an isolated runner, with dependencies pinned by lockfile hash and no network access during compilation. The signing step records the commit, runner image digest, and pipeline run in an attestation stored alongside the artifact. Reviewers should confirm that the attestation chain is unbroken before approving promotion. The artifact currently under review is identified by the token below.

trace token, kajef-bahip: htk14_d9270d12f0002c